The PERFECT CAMERA ,
October 4, 2005
Reviewer: Elizabeth V. Brennan
This camera is AWESOME!! I recently purchased the Kodak P850 and have been
very pleased with the camera - it's really cute too. The camera takes
excellent pictures and is a steal at $499. I've had numerous compact
cameras (including Kodak) but they all seem to deliver the same picture
quality .. great pictures under ideal conditions - but when the conditions
are not perfect, Compact digital camera shots are unacceptable. This
camera is just the right size and is easy to handle. The 12X zoom makes it
difficult to ever pick up a 3X camera again !! The camera has little if no
shutter lag making that impossible shot easy to take. It is one of the
very few camera's on the market that allows you to zoom during video -
this is a very desirable feature. The Auto setting "glams" all pictures,
making them look their best. But sometimes you don't want to "glam" your
pictures .. candlelight conditions, etc - that's when you use one of the
many "scene" modes. You tell the camera your present "scene" and it takes
the picture without over dramatizing it (like the previous Kodak's did).
The 2.5" LCD screen is also the perfect size - the indoor/outdoor display
enables you to view pictures under all lighting conditions. The battery
life is also generous, I've been playing with it for 2 weeks and still
have not had to charge the batteries. Oh and the best thing about this
camera is something called "Image Stabilization", this basically means no
more blurry pictures - even at High Zoom !! If you buy this camera - you
won't regret it. In the future the Digital Camera's and Camcorder will
merge and become one - this Camera may have achieved that since it takes
excellent video.
PROS:
* High Optical Zoom - 12X
* High Quality Lens
* 2.5" LCD Display
* Zoom during Video
* Image Stabilization Technology - no blurry pictures
* No shutter lag.
CONS:
* Zoom Motor Noise heard during Video playback
* Camera comes with no case
Overal Rating: 5 STARS
RECOMMENDED BUY: YES

Dissapointing, March 13, 2006
Reviewer: Kay Walsh
I researched for my digital camera and thought this would be the answer,
but was VERY dissapointed. I chose this camera for the zoom for sporting
events. The pictures at the zoom range are almost always out of focus
because it is so hard to hold the camera still while trying to get an
action shot. Then the down time between shots is so long, forget quick
action shots in a row. Also the delay after pressing the shutter is so
long the shot is missed most of the time. The good thing is the quality of
a posed picture is very crisp but again because of the delay, many times
eyes are closed due to the flash. I would never purchase this camera
again.
